The Australian rapper, Iggy Azalea, has found herself at the center of a media storm, not for her music, but for the unauthorized dissemination of intimate photographs. The incident, which occurred over the Memorial Day weekend, prompted a swift response from the artist, including the deactivation of her Twitter and Instagram accounts. The leaked images, reportedly outtakes from a 2016 photoshoot for GQ Magazine, have stirred up a debate about the ethics of online content sharing and the vulnerability of public figures. This isn't the first time Azalea has faced public scrutiny regarding her online presence. Earlier this year, she joined the subscription-based platform OnlyFans, a move that generated considerable buzz. Now, the leak has once again cast her into the spotlight, forcing her to navigate the complex terrain of online privacy and public perception.

The situation unfolded rapidly. On Monday, May 27th, news of the leak began to circulate widely across the internet. Shortly thereafter, the artist, known for her hit song "Fancy," took to social media to address the issue, only to subsequently delete all of her accounts. This digital disappearing act, while not uncommon in the wake of a privacy breach, amplified the sense of outrage and concern among her fans. Sources indicate that the rapper is considering legal action, reflecting the seriousness with which she views the violation of her personal space. The photographs, which were part of a GQ Australia photoshoot in 2016, were never intended for public consumption. This fact underscores the inherent vulnerability of digital media and the potential for private content to be disseminated without consent.
The leak has ignited a larger conversation about consent and the boundaries of online privacy. Many are questioning the ethics of sharing or circulating such images, regardless of the subject's public profile. The photographer, Nino Muoz, who captured the images, has not yet released a statement regarding the incident. His silence adds another layer of complexity to the unfolding drama, raising questions about the security of copyrighted material and the responsibility of those who handle it.
